Amber Morth a seventeen year old student from Oakdale, CT, was recently accepted in to Genetik – the Tribe’s academy of the arts and evangelism in Manchester, England. Amber auditioned via Skype this past November in front of Tom and to several course leaders in the UK. “I was really nervous,” Amber reflects of the audition. “I didn’t think I was going to make it!”
Amber will leave for England in the fall of 2012. Until then, she will be a Musicianary-in-Training with f2fmi. In the new year, she will be learning about England, saving money from working at her part time job and raising additional support for her year abroad.
